WOODLAND— Sometimes, scoring 27 points in one quarter is enough. And that was the case for the Beavers Friday night, which put up that total in the second period, didn’t bother to score before or after and easily handled Hockinson 27-7 for consecutive league victories Friday.

And the efficient affair was over by 8:56 p.m., only 34 minutes after news broke that the Kalama and Stevenson game just eight miles to the north had also gone final… at halftime.

It’s no secret at this point that Michael Belvin is the focal point of the Woodland offense. But he had a new wrinkle to test out Friday…a few deep bombs down the sidelines to keep the Hockinson defense wondering whether they were suddenly playing Week 2 La Center (too soon, Woodland faithful?)

The first two possessions, granted, weren’t what Glen Flanagan or Belvin surely had in mind.
